Comment on attachment 214869 [details] Add a pkg-message to sndio I'm sorry but I don't like it. Sndio will work out of the box without any setup and transparently in the simplest case and using sndiod is optional. This pkg-message gives the impression that you must run sndiod to use audio/sndio which is just plain wrong.
